Type the following into the server's command-line interface: iPerf3 -s. Then, hit return. That's it -- simple. This command tells this instance of iPerf3 that it will be functioning as a server -- or waiting to receive data.

Ping programs are used when conducting speed tests for local networks. Desktop and laptop computers include small versions of these programs, which calculate the network delay between the computer and another target device on the network.
